Twinmold posted...
Contrary to popular belief, softer gloves mean bigger impacts. Punching someone with your bare fist sucks. It hurts, and your bones aren't designed for it. The increased padding means the aggressor feels less impact, but the softer padding doesn't do much to dampen the concussive force behind the blow, which is the part that fucks you up, not the hardness of the knuckle.


Right, which makes you wonder why someone with known hand issues like Mayweather would agree to this.
